Materials - Advance Export Tab

I am trying to create some new/revised material types to smooth Ecotect model export into Radiance. I recently noticed the "Advance Export" tab in the material properties dialog box. From here, it looks as though you can assign properites specific to various programs (including Radiance). I have successfully created new glass types with proper transmissivity values to override Ecotects errors.

It works...but have the following issues:
1)When I save these chnages, sometimes the Radiance descriptors disappears. I reload them, but they still disappear.
2)When I save these files to my Global Mats Library, they will remain in my material library for that model. When I open a different model, it doesn't appear that these new materials import with the Global library.

I thought there were others, but cannot think of them. I think this is a great tool, but it doesn't help the Ecotect community much if it doesn't work.

Has anyone used this...? If so, have you noticed these problems?
